Import ghost 9 image to Virtual Machine

This is my second posting I did not get any reply with my first one.

I have Windows 2003 on Dell Power Edge 1800 with Sata Raid Controller. I have used BartPE with Ghost 9 to make an image from this server. The image was created without any error and I have imported the Image to Virtual Server 1.x using import option, the import went okay with no error, but when I try to start this VM. it hangs on black screen and it does not boot.

I tried to add the Virtual disk of the new win 2003 as second drive on another VM and I can see my local drive and data drive without any problem I have even tried to change the boot.ini still I can not boot this new guest Win 2003.

If you have already restored the ghost image to the VM, you may also be able to make the VM bootable by using the "Configure Machine" option of VMware Converter.

Converter does P2V directly. It can also import the Ghost images files without you having to install the program on the original physical machine. But since you've already done the BartPE, as suggested, you can run Converter and choose "Configure Machine" instead of "Import Machine." They both do the same thing, with Import doing the additional step of converting the physical or Ghost image.
